python excel转xml 用例_测试用例Excel转XML格式教程
运行环境:
Python版本:Python2.7.15
第三方库:pywin32
Excel版本:Excel2016
1.安装Python2.7.15
1)下载Python安装包
进入Python官网:www.python.org,打开页面如下:
选择Downloads—>All releases—>Download Python 2.7.15,然后等待下载完成即可
2)安装Python
进入下载目录,双击安装包,一直点击next即可(如果不想修改安装路径)
安装完成后打开DOS窗口(Win+R,输入cmd按下Enter),输入命令行python2,验证python是否安装成功,如下图:
至此Python的安装已经完成
注:本人电脑安装了两个版本的python,所以用对应的命令需要加上版本号区分
2.安装pywin32库
pywin32安装方法:
安装方法:在命令行输入pip2 install pywin32
注:因为我的电脑安装了两个版本的Python,所以用pip2
3.完成转换
操作方法:将上述文件放置同一个文件夹,然后打开Dos窗口,进入对应文件夹目录,输入python2 operate.py即可
例:我将文件放在E:\ExcelToXML目录下进行操作
生成的xml文件名称为:文件名+表名
然后将xml文件导入testlink即可
使用注意事项:
1)安装好pywin32可以测试一下是否可以打开Excel表,测试代码如下
import win32com.client
xlsApp = win32com.client.Dispatch('Excel.Application')
xlsApp.Workbooks.Open(r'F:/test.xls')
2)注意Excel版本要大于2007,在运行脚本之前将后缀名修改为.xls
python excel转xml 用例_测试用例Excel转XML格式教程相关推荐
- python里小于号怎么打_如何在嵌入xml的python脚本中使用大于或小于符号?
我在用edX工作室做课程.我想定制一个由python计算的输入问题.在标记中的python代码中,>或{}符号关闭的xml标记似乎有问题?在<?xml version="1.0& ...
- excel透视表无添加字段_在Excel数据透视表中添加过滤器标记
excel透视表无添加字段 If you're using Excel 2007 or Excel 2010, you can quickly see which fields in a pivot ...
- 为什么excel图片会变成代码_会EXCEL便可定制自己的办公管理软件(超简单,无代码)...
只要会EXCEL,就可以根据自己的需求,定制自己的办公管理软件,而且是完全免费,不用注册,完全根据自己的需求定制,数据也只保存在自己的电脑上, 废话不多说,我们先看案例,本次案例以一款EXCEL通用的 ...
- excel 中vb组合框_在Excel 2010中修复组合框大小调整
excel 中vb组合框 With Excel data validation, you can create drop down lists on a worksheet. However, the ...
- excel怎么添加换行符_在Excel公式中添加换行符
excel怎么添加换行符 在Excel公式中添加换行符 (Add Line Break in Excel Formula) It's easy to add a line break when you ...
- python图像标记工具怎么用_图片标注工具LabelImg使用教程
1.进入labelImg-master文件夹,在空白处使用 "Shift+鼠标右键" ,选择在此处打开命令窗口,依次输入下面语句即可打开软件. pyrcc4 -o resource ...
- excel小写转大写公式_【Excel函数贴】五个技巧性函数小套路
来吧 来吧 来吧 一起舞蹈 什么烦恼可以将我打扰 ---- 1, 字母大小写. 一个做外贸的朋友问,Excel有没有函数可以把英文从小写变大写? 他可能碰到蛮多洋人的人名或者货名需要大小写转换的. 小 ...
- excel怎么添加diy工具箱_这些Excel插件让你的Excel更好用!
Excel基本功不扎实 临时学习也没时间 这时候 比起各种操作技巧 Excel插件更实际 更能切实提高你的效率 今天就给大家推荐几款插件! 方方格子 说起Excel插件,就不能不提到它.方方格子支持E ...
- excel表格末尾添加一行_在EXCEL表格中,快速插入多行、多列的技巧
在使用Excel过程中,我们会遇到需要插入相同格式的多行或多列,如果一行行或一列列的插入,对于插入的数量较少的情况还是适用的.可是如果需要插入上百的行或列,使用此方法就比较费时费力啦.分享几个小技巧实 ...
最新文章
- Alibaba Cluster Data 开放下载:270GB 数据揭秘你不知道的阿里巴巴数据中心
- 力软 框架 转 mysql_快速web开发框架——learun framework
- Java JDBC连接SQL Server2005错误:通过port 1433 连接到主机 localhost 的 TCP/IP 连接失败...
- SAP UI5 的本地 Fiori sandbox Launchpad
- .NET开发框架(二)-框架功能简述
- 什么时候用synchronized
- android 自定义布局 根据布局获取类,android自定义布局中的平滑移动之ViewGroup实现...
- FFPLAY的原理(三)
- Android 换行符号(\n)放到Android当中的TextView显示双斜杠(\\n)
- ElasticSearch6.0 Java API 使用 排序,分组 ,创建索引,添加索引数据,打分等(一)...
- 浅谈ES6中的rest参数
- 翻译python代码的软件_使用Python3中的gettext模块翻译Python源码以支持多语言
- Win7安装.net 4.7.2
- 做头条问答项目,月入4000元到底有多简单
- python time strptime_Python time.strptime方法代碼示例
- ORCAL计算司龄是否满一年
- 时空图卷积网络ST-GCN论文完全解读记录
- Cache(缓存)基本概念
- 电力电子应用技术的matlab仿真
- Transformer再下一城!DeepMind新模型自动生成CAD草图,网友:建筑设计要起飞了